Is DriTherm 32 or 37 better?

Knauf DriTherm 37 slabs have a thermal conductivity value of 0.037 W/mK. They are less thermally efficient than DriTherm 32 slabs. Like DriTherm 32 slabs, DriTherm 37 slabs can be used in buildings that are up to 12m high because they are rated A1 (non-combustible) on the Euroclass scale.

What is DriTherm insulation?

Description. DriTherm® Cavity Slab 32 is a water-repellent Glass Mineral Wool slab, designed for use in external full-fill masonry cavity walls, that offers the best thermal performance in the range.

What is full fill cavity insulation?

Full fill cavity wall insulation allows more of the cavity between the inner and outer leaf to be filled with insulation, providing a much better insulated structure without increasing the wall width.

How thick should cavity wall insulation be?

Take a typical cavity wall construction with a 102.5 mm brick outer leaf and a medium density blockwork inner leaf. In order to achieve a U-value of 0.17 W/m2.K (meeting the notional requirements in all three regions), a 100 mm thickness of phenolic cavity insulation should be used to partially fill the cavity.

How do you get 0.18 U-value of a cavity wall?

To meet 0.18 W/m2K, cavity walls will need either a full-fill cavity, additional internal insulation or have a cavity greater than 100 mm.

How do cavity walls get U-value?

The maximum U-value you can achieve by retrofitting cavity wall insulation in any property older that 1975 is 0.5 W/m2k since you are limited by the thickness of the cavity.

Is 0.16 a good U-value?

To put that into context: a single-glazed window will have a U value of 5.0, a standard double-glazed window around 1.6 and triple glazed around 0.8. Building Regulations (opens in new tab) require a wall of no worse than 0.3, roof 0.16, and ground floor 0.22.
